Transaction

e1bbf60e896c9af9b85ba1e437e4af3a985bc413e4fe35614a442260a511503e
107,143 confirmations
Timestamp
1709129425
Block832,415
Fee4,886 sats
Fee rate34.7 sats/vB
view on mempool.space

Inputs & Outputs